Hair loss can come about for a number of reasons. Whatever the reason, it almost universally causes a great deal of distress. Here are some effective hints on how you can address the situation.

Watch what you do after bathing to minimize the effects of hair loss. Rub your scalp gently when drying your hair. You should also avoid using a hair dryer if you can. If you have to do it, use the lowest heat settings.

It may just pay to wear a wig or toupee if you suffer from severe hair loss. Most hair loss medications are expensive and they do not always work the way people want them to. By getting a wig, you can pick the color, style and length of your hair.

In order to prevent your hair from falling out, you want to consider avoiding hair relaxers. The chemicals in these products are known to make hair fragile and fall out. Also, avoid using rollers in your hair. They grab onto hair too tightly and could cause it to fall out.

If you are a man suffering from severe hair loss, you want to consider shaving your head. Not only will it be easier to take care of your hair this way, but you will prevent your hair from looking odd from hair loss. Also, it is the cheapest option available.

For those suffering from hair loss, you want to consider using topical treatments. Many of these products work by blocking out hair loss-causing hormones, while also providing growth stimulants. Be sure that you consult with your doctor before using this or any other medication so you know that it is safe for you.

Make sure to wash your hair of any gels before you go to sleep. If you go to bed with gel in your hair, the pillow will often push the gel into the pores on your scalp. This prevents hair growth, and it also can damage already present hair follicles, making you lose hair more quickly.

Natural herbal supplements to grow back your hair are the way to go for people who want to avoid the side effects associated with traditional medications. Some supplements will obviously work better than others, so you will need to test each one out individually to see what works best for you.

If you are currently losing your hair, stay away from hair dyes. Changing the color of your hair, even if only occasionally, is causing damage to your hair and thus weakening it. Anything that weakens your hair and puts pressure on the scalp can cause the follicles to fall out a lot easier.

Eat a balanced diet to help prevent hair loss. Your diet affects your hair as well your body. By following a diet consisting of fruits and veggies, whole grain and protein, you will be feeding your hair the best diet possible to thrive. Take Vitamin E supplements if you are suffering from hair loss. Vitamin E promotes healthy blood circulation, which, in turn, promotes healthy hair growth. It will also have the added benefit of keeping your skin healthy and serum hair treatment looking.

Make sure that you comb your hair before you go to sleep each night if you want to prevent hair loss. Hair that is combed or brushed before bed is healthier and less likely to fall out. Try not to sleep on your hair either-- this makes it more likely to fall out.

Take vitamins daily. Since hair loss can be caused by a diet that lacks nutrients, you should be sure to get a multivitamin daily. Take one that easily absorbs into the adult body. This will help replenish necessary vitamins and nutrients in your diet that can be contributing to hair loss.
